The Bently Nevada 330101-00-75-05-01-05 3300 XL 8 mm Proximity Probe is engineered for precise, non-contact measurement of shaft displacement and vibration in industrial rotating machinery. Its 0.5-meter total length makes it ideal for installations in confined spaces, where cable routing needs to be minimal without compromising signal integrity.
Applications include:
Small to medium steam and gas turbines
Industrial compressors and pumps
Electric motors and generator auxiliary systems
Fans, blowers, and rotating machinery in tight spaces
Process equipment in petrochemical and refinery plants
Condition monitoring and predictive maintenance systems

Technical FAQs
1. What sensing technology does this probe use?
It employs eddy-current technology for non-contact measurement of shaft displacement and vibration.
2. What machinery is it suited for?
Commonly used on turbines, compressors, pumps, motors, and other rotating industrial equipment.
3. Can it detect imbalance or misalignment?
Yes, it identifies vibration changes indicative of imbalance, misalignment, or bearing degradation.
